In the usa, Candace Wheeler was one of many 1st lady interior designers and served stimulate a fresh design and style of yankee structure. She was instrumental in the development of artwork courses for Girls in a number of key American towns and was deemed a national authority on homedesign. A crucial influence on The brand new occupation was The Decoration of Homes, a handbook of interior style published by Edith Wharton with architect Ogden Codman in 1897 in America. During the e-book, the authors denounced Victorian-model interior decoration and interior style, In particular Individuals rooms that were decorated with weighty window curtains, Victorian bric-a-brac, and overstuffed home furniture.

Elsie De Wolfe was one of the first interior designers. Rejecting the Victorian design she grew up with, she selected a more vivid scheme, as well as more at ease furniture in the house. Her designs were being mild, with new shades and sensitive Chinoiserie furnishings, rather than the Victorian choice of major, crimson drapes and upholstery, dim wood and intensely patterned wallpapers.

A pivotal figure in popularizing theories of interior layout to the center class was the architect Owen Jones, One of the more influential structure theorists on the nineteenth century.[7] Jones' to start with task was his most significant—in 1851, he was answerable for don't just the decoration of Joseph Paxton’s gigantic Crystal Palace for the Great Exhibition but in addition the arrangement of your reveals within.
